Madrid, Spain – World No. 1 Aryna Sabalenka triumphed over Marta Kostyuk in a challenging quarterfinal match at the Madrid Open on April 30, 2025, winning 7-6 (4), 7-6 (7) on a stormy evening.

The two-time champion fought through windy and damp conditions at the Caja Mágica to secure her spot in the semi-finals. This victory marks Sabalenka’s fourth appearance in the final four of the tournament and her third consecutive semi-final entry.

The match was a battle of resilience, with both players facing not only each other but also the looming threat of rain. The first set was tightly contested, with Kostyuk earning a break point but unable to capitalize fully. Eighty-five minutes in, Sabalenka seized the first set after winning a tiebreak 7-4.

As the second set progressed, both players exchanged breaks before the weather took a turn. With the score at 5-4 in the tiebreaker, Sabalenka called for a stoppage due to rain, sparking frustration from Kostyuk, who voiced her displeasure to the umpire.

Following a brief pause while the roof was closed, Sabalenka returned to the court and saved three set points before clinching the match with a final tiebreak score of 7-6 (7).

The lack of a handshake between the two competitors highlighted the tension that permeated the match. Sabalenka reflected on the experience, stating, “It wasn’t about tennis, it was about the way you handle your emotions. I think I did that well.”

Next, Sabalenka will face 17th seed Elina Svitolina, another Ukrainian, as she aims for her third title at the Madrid Open.
